Culbertson Council Approves Site Plans

The Culbertson Town Council held their regular meeting Monday, Sept. 12. Site/sketch plans were approved for Teril and Bev Raaum for a garage and Kara Halvorson for a 12 by 50 foot modular accessory structure.

A variance request was approved for an older model trailer home in the Wheatland Hills development for Paul Finnicum. The variance stipulates that Finnicum has one year to bring the structure up to code.

An event application was approved for the upcoming Homecoming parade, which has been set for Sept. 23.

Jeremy Fadness with WWC Engineering told the council that a floodplain permit application has been submitted as part of the MDT U.S. Highway 2 project.

Snow removal equipment for Big Sky Airport is expected to arrive this week.

The council discussed a pending Hazard Mitigation Plan designed to help identify risks in the area. Discussions are ongoing.

The council discussed possible uses for remaining American Rescue Plan Act monies available at the county level. Council members are considering putting in for funds to tackle a wastewater project near the southwest corner of Culbertson School.

Minutes for the Aug. 8 regular meeting were passed, as well as minutes for an Aug. 8 budget hearing. Payroll journal vouchers were approved, as were utility billing vouchers and August bills.

The next meeting of the Culbertson Town Council is set for Oct. 11.
